I've seen some guys mark the max on the synthetic rope at the fairlead with a few strands of bright cord like mason line or gutted paracord through the rope, but it occurred to me that it might be better to pull it out and mark it where the back edge of the deck is: that way you get some warning before you get to it, and it's easier to see from where you're going to be while you're pulling.

  7. Another dime suggestion, grab an in-expensive duffel bag to flake the winch extension into. Lightweight, easy to store, and very fast to deploy with minimal tangling. Its how I store all my life safety rope and lines.
